Full Food Service Camp Parks & Fort Hunter Liggett, CA (CPHL)The U.S. Government is seeking information from small business concerns to determine whether to set aside the Full Food Service (FFS) requirement at Camp Parks and Fort Hunter Liggett, California, exclusively for small businesses, as mandated under FAR Part 19. This sources sought synopsis is not a solicitation and does not obligate the government to issue a contract; its purpose is to assess market capabilities and ensure a fair and competitive small business set-aside is feasible. The requirement, covered under NAICS code 722310 with a $47 million size standard, encompasses all aspects of food service operations including food receiving, storage, preparation, serving, remote site feeding, and facility sanitation, to be performed at Army dining facilities. Respondents must demonstrate their qualifications through a detailed capability statement not exceeding 15 pages, submitted electronically by August 5, 2026, to specified government points of contact, with attachments limited to 9 MB and no zip files permitted. Interested businesses must provide a comprehensive profile including their business size certification status—such as SDB, 8(a), HUBZone, SDVOSB, EDWOSB, or WOSB—along with information on prior experience managing similar FFS operations, whether as prime or subcontractor, specifying the number of facilities, meals served, and services rendered. Respondents are required to detail their proposed teaming or subcontracting structure, clearly indicating the percentage of work to be performed by the prime and similarly situated subcontractors in compliance with FAR 52.219-14, and the certifications of any proposed subcontractors. Additional information addressing financial capacity, recommendations for structuring the contract to encourage small business competition, and any potential barriers to fair competition must also be included. The government will use all submissions to evaluate market readiness and determine the optimal procurement approach, with any future solicitation to be posted officially on SAM.gov; responses to this synopsis do not guarantee future participation eligibility.
